Numerous Candidates Furthermore, the Minister of Administrative and Bureaucratic Reform (Menpan-RB), Anas Abdullah Azwar, is also considered a potential candidate for East Java governor. “Then who else, Minister Abdullah Azwar Anas, former Banyuwangi Regent. If he can in Jakarta, why not in East Java?” said E. Sotarduga. As for the deputy governor (Cawagub) position, Sotarduga said that PDIP also has many potential candidates. They include Vice Chairman of PDIP DPD Jatim Budi Kanang Sulistyono and Kediri Regent Hanindhito Himawan Pramana. “For the deputy candidate in East Java, there are even more. There’s Mas Kanang, Mas Dito. Many more local officials there,” he added.

Eriko noted that the Indonesian Democratic Party of Struggle has many members who could be endorsed as the 2024 East Java gubernatorial candidate, including Pramono Anung, the Cabinet Secretary. “Now let me ask, don’t we have a candidate for governor? We do. Can’t Mr. Pram do it? He could in Jakarta, why not in East Java,” he said. Besides Pram, he also mentioned Tri Rismaharini, the Social Affairs Minister and Chairman of the DPR RI Budget Board (Banggar) Said Abdullah. “Could Mrs. Tri Rismaharini not be suitable for East Java? Could Mr. Said Abdullah not be suitable for East Java?” he added.
